Output dbb3041a8301df34b2beca8a4e4187432feaee5abebf512413b92d8b05b2f2bd:1

value
22951289
script pubkey
OP_0 OP_PUSHBYTES_20 c7100ba976b89be015eafb0d11352f0e5e0830e0
address
bc1qcugqh2tkhzd7q902lvx3zdf0pe0qsv8qedqj3w
transaction
dbb3041a8301df34b2beca8a4e4187432feaee5abebf512413b92d8b05b2f2bd
confirmations
178125
spent
true